OSX 10.3.9 Gros stress //

FranZz

Membre actif
19 Juillet 2007
469
13
Namur
Bonjour, j'ai à ma disposition un MAc:

Modèle d’ordinateur: Power Mac G5
Type de processeur: PowerPC 970 (2.2)
Nombre de processeurs: 1
Vitesse du processeur: 1.6 GHz
Cache de niveau 2 (par processeur): 512 Ko
Mémoire: 1 Go
Vitesse du bus: 800 MHz
Version ROM de démarrage: 5.1.5f2
Numéro de série:

Il y a peu, j'ai du faire des recherches pour des applications DMX. J'ai été trifouiller dans le terminal, pour activer apache, mais je crois que je lui ai fait plus de mal que de bien.

Maintenant, le partage web est comme qui dirait "verouillé", je ne sais plus l'activer, le démarrer. Il se sélectionne, mais il reste grisé, seul, triste...

Etant conscient d'avoir foutu le xxxx sur cette machine, je souhaiterais repartir à zéro.

**Soit en réinstallant appache proprement
**Soit en réinstallant tout le système, en gardant tous mes programmes si c'est possible.

( Mes cd d'install :eek: :eek: sont tjs dans l'armoire )

Je suis vraiment Novice dans l'art, et n'ai absolument pas envie d'endommager de plus belle la machne sur laquelle je travaille actuellement.

merci de m'aiguiller, et puis, bnne aprèm .
 
Déjà, il faudrait essayer de nous indiquer ce que tu as fait ;)
 
Bon, ok ... Cela fait déjà plusieurs mois, mais Bon...

J'ai...

Essayé d'installer MAMP sur cette machine, mais trop vieil OS, donc message d'erreur, puis uninstall.. Ensuite, j'ai voulu télécharger apache 2, et php 5, mais je n'ai pas claireùment fait les Bonnes opérations ( décommenter via terminal ), alors, j'ai fait une recherche de tout ce qui contenait PHP et appache.. Et j'ai Viré. J'ai rentré mon mot de passe, et puis, j'ai exécuté cela.

Ensuite et depuis, le partage web personnel est verouiller, je sais cocher cette case, dans les préférences de partage, mais quand je cioche la case, elle se grise, mais n'est pas active...

Donc, je pense que j'ai fait une opération irréversible, c'est pour cela ptêtre qu'il faudrait que je réinstalle.

...:rateau: :rateau:
 
Essayé d'installer MAMP sur cette machine, mais trop vieil OS, donc message d'erreur, puis uninstall.. Ensuite, j'ai voulu télécharger apache 2, et php 5, mais je n'ai pas claireùment fait les Bonnes opérations ( décommenter via terminal ), alors, j'ai fait une recherche de tout ce qui contenait PHP et appache.. Et j'ai Viré. J'ai rentré mon mot de passe, et puis, j'ai exécuté cela.
Et tu as viré Apache installé par défaut avec Mac OSX :D
Ensuite et depuis, le partage web personnel est verouiller, je sais cocher cette case, dans les préférences de partage, mais quand je cioche la case, elle se grise, mais n'est pas active...
Cela signifie que Apache n'arrive plus à démarrer pour une raison X ou Y.
Donc, je pense que j'ai fait une opération irréversible, c'est pour cela ptêtre qu'il faudrait que je réinstalle.
Ben .... oui :rateau:

Une fois cela fait, je ne pense pas que tu aies besoin d'Apache 2, la version par défaut devrait te suffire (auparavant il fallait patcher le code et recompiler, maintenant je ne sais pas s'il un package facile à installer pour Mac OSX, Darwin Port ?)
Pour PHP5, installe Entropy.
 
À mon avis, Entropy est un bon choix. MacPorts est sans doute pas mal. Personnellement, comme je suis pervers, je m'anuse à tout recompiler à la main, ce qui est le signe d'une grave névrose binaire [mais on survit] :)

Peut-être pourrais-tu te contenter de réinstaller les paquetages de Mac OS X qui contiennent Apache.
La démarche pourrait être :
  1. faire bien sagement un clone du système sur une autre partition (interne ou sur un disque FireWire)
  2. redémarrer sur ce clone pour vérifier qu'il fonctionne (on n'est jamais trop prudent)
  3. redémarrer sur le système
  4. télécharger si besoin est la mise à jour combo (combinée) de Mac OS X.3.9
  5. rechercher (avec Pacifist, par exemple) les paquetages concernés
  6. les installer
  7. repasser la mise à jour combo
  8. redémarrer
  9. réparer les autorisations
  10. si tout est en vrac, redémarrer sur la partition de secours et cloner en sens inverse
  11. se méfier la prochaine fois ...
Voili.
 
J'oubliais : je pense que sur Panther, comme sur Tiger, cela se trouve dans le paquetage Essentials.pkg. Comme son nom l'indique, c'est un paquetage important ;) Donc bien prendre ses précautions.
 
Hello bompi !!!

Merci pour ces précisions !!!

( Précision, je taffe sur Mac depuis peu, donc, Novice, maladroit... )

(Ta soluce a l'air intéressante, mais j'ai déjà fait assez de bidouillages, et même si cela a l'air simple pour toi, ben c'est pas le cas pour moi)

Tu vois, mon stress, c'est que je ne sais pas installer MAMP sur cette machine (car l'OS est trop vieux) et cela me dépannerait grave ... Vu les bourdes que j'ai faites, je me demande si je ne ferais pas mieux d'acheter MAC OSX LEOPARD..;

Cela reglerait d'une part mes problèmes avec appache, car je suppose qu'une fois le LEo installé, cela m'intallera l'appache...

Puis d'autre part, je pourrai installer ce MAMP sur cette machine, et je pourrai enfin bosser ici et non la nuit chez moi, car je l'ai installé sur mon ordi perso en fait, qui accpte le MAMP

Tu en penses quoi ?.?.?:heu:
 
J'en pense que si tu peux te payer Leopard, c'est une bonne occasion pour s'amuser avec et que, en effet, tu retrouveras Apache et PHP fraîchement installés.

Pour autant, je ne vois plus l'intérêt dans ce cas d'installer MAMP. Pourquoi en as-tu besoin ? Pour MySQL : tu le télécharges du site de MySQL AB et c'est tranquille.
 
"Bompi" :::

Alors, ben j'ai besoin de MAMP, en gros, parce que j'ai essayé d'installer manuellement MYSQL et PHP, et en gros, tu vois ou cela m'a mené...

Dans la boite ou je taffe, l'informatitien est parti depuis peu, et ces manipulations, c'est moi qui doit les effectuer, alors que, même avec de la bonne volonté, ben on fait, (je fais) vite des opérations irréversibles...

OSX LEO-> 129€ c'est cela je crois.

Si j'ai besoin du MAMP, ben c'est simplement que je dois développer un site en PHP, avec identification utilsateur et restriction des pages en DMX, avec des variables, des sessions, des KOOKIES, plein de choses assez nouvelles pour moi, et ce MAMP est easy à installer ( la preuve j'ai su le faire sur ma machine perso ) ...

Voilà donc le pourquoi du comment...

La semaine passée, j'ai passé plus de temps à bidouiller ces install de sql et de PHP et du Admin au détriment de ma tâhe première--> Faire ce *********** de site...

Voilou...

J'aimerais trouver des solutions, mais comme je le dis, chuis pas un As ...
 
OK. Donc, quand même : apache et PHP sont installés par défaut sur ta machine (avec Panther, Tiger ou Leopard). Ce qui fait déjà MAP. Pour le dernier M, il te suffit d'aller ici.
Et encore ici pour avoir les outils d'administrations en mode graphique.
Tout ceci s'installe sans difficulté.

Pour que le serveur Web livré par Apple fonctionne comme souhaité, il faut éditer sa configuration, ce qui n'est pas inutile pour saisir le fonctionnement de la bête : fichier /etc/httpd/httpd.conf plus quelques autres à parcourir.

Pour en revenir à MAMP : après tout, si tu souhaites l'installer, peut-être ferais-tu aussi bien de réinstaller Tiger plutôt que d'installer Leopard. Ce dernier sort dans deux semaines, avec possiblement des bugs [je dirais même : vraisemblablement] et donc une certaine instabilité. Réinstaller Tiger te permettrait d'être comme sur ton Mac perso et, comme tu as déjà installé MAMP, ce te sera facile de le refaire. Sur Leopard, tu risques d'avoir quelques incompatibilités d'humeur [est-ce que MAMP est certifié pour Leopard ?]
 
Bon, j'ai quand même essayé d'installer XAMPP -

Mais lorsque j'essaie delancer la comande suivante


/Applications/xampp/xamppfiles/mampp start

J'ai ce message d'erreur.......

Last login: Thu Oct 18 08:29:50 on console
Welcome to Darwin!
francois-b:~ francois$ sudo su
Password:
francois-b:/Users/francois root# /Applications/xampp/xamppfiles/mampp start
Starting XAMPP for MacOS X 0.6.3...
/Applications/xampp/xamppfiles/share/xampp/phpstatus: line 4: /Applications/xampp/xamppfiles/bin/php: Bad CPU type in executable
XAMPP: Starting Apache with SSL ...
XAMPP: Error 126! Couldn't start Apache!
/Applications/xampp/xamppfiles/bin/mysql.server: line 1: /Applications/xampp/xamppfiles/bin/my_print_defaults: Bad CPU type in executable
/Applications/xampp/xamppfiles/bin/mysql.server: line 1: /Applications/xampp/xamppfiles/bin/my_print_defaults: Bad CPU type in executable
XAMPP: Starting MySQL...
XAMPP: Starting ProFTPD...
XAMPP: /Applications/xampp/xamppfiles/mampp: line 224: /Applications/xampp/xamppfiles/sbin/proftpd: Bad CPU type in executable
XAMPP: Error 126! Couln't start ProFTPD!
XAMPP for MacOS X started.
francois-b:/Users/francois root# /Applications/xampp/xamppfiles/bin/mysql.server: line 159: kill: (9281) - No such process

Ce que je comprends, c'est qu'il y a une erreur type 126...

? Et vous ?
 
Ce que je comprends ? C'est que le binaire n'est pas pour la bonne architecture, à première vue ("Bad CPU type in executable"). Genre : du binaire Intel sur un PPC.
 
Sympa d'avoir identifié le problème...

Euh, les solutions que tu amènes, c'est tjs celles-citées ci haut?

THK'Zz
 
Tu devrais désinstaller XAMPP puis en réinstaller une version qui convient (si c'est pour Panther, c'est forcément PPC, non ?)
La version 0.7.0 est universelle mais je ne sais pas si elle fonctionne pour Panther. Essaye toujours.